A user reports that a critical service on their Windows machine has stopped working, and applications dependent on this service are failing. What is the best initial step to address this issue?
Check for software updates and install them
Restart the specific service that is not functioning
Restarting the affected service is often the quickest way to restore functionality without requiring changes to the operating system or applications. Checking the service status and restarting it directly addresses the immediate problem.
Other options, like rebooting the entire system, can be disruptive and may not be necessary if the service can be restarted individually. Additionally, simply checking for updates does not address the immediate issue of the halted service.
